ArmyVern said:I don't know why you think 200 points wouldn't get you far in the RegF.
It's all we get.
Points are assigend each 01 Apr based upon your UIC. Those in NDHQ (or other) unitswho wear DEU as daily dress get the 400 points.
Other than them, it's 200.

Also, it may be good to remind people that you max out at 1200 points (IIRC), so you might as well use the points and get stuff (extra shirts, pants, socks, etc).
ArmyVern said:1200 points are enough to completly replace your DEU 3 times over (shirts, socks, tunics and all). For the average pers ... 1200 max is well more than enough for the entire 20 year career (earned in 6 years for us 200 point people/3 years for the 400 point people - and not even accounting the complete set that you get initially without even having to utilize your "exchange" points.)
